Habiller un doc xml avec css

Fermé
cisko123 Messages postés 3 Date d'inscription vendredi 22 mai 2015 Statut Membre Dernière intervention 23 mai 2015 - Modifié par cisko123 le 22/05/2015 à 15:43
 Utilisateur anonyme - 23 mai 2015 à 23:20
Bonjour, je voudrais que quelqu'un m'explique comment habiller un doc xmll avec du css , j'ai éssayé mais j'ai du mal en m'en sortir . Exemple
ce fichier
?<?xml version="1.0"?>
<?xml-stylesheet type="text/xsl" href="cv.xsl"?>
<base_de_cv>
<demandeur matricule="M01">

<objetDemande>Emploi</objetDemande>

<infoGénérale>
Informations générales
<nom>Aly CAMARA</nom>
<date_de_naissance>08/12/1982 </date_de_naissance>
<adresse>12, Rue 5 Escale Nord (Dakar)</adresse>
<nationalité> Sénégalaise</nationalité>
<tel> (00221)773141728</tel>
<email> aly.camara@senebank.sn</email>
<civilité>Célibataire</civilité>
<photo> ./images/M01.gif</photo>
</infoGénérale>

<formation>
<spécialisation>Informatique</spécialisation>
<diplome_obtenu>
<intitulé_du_diplome>Licence Professionnelle en TéléInformatique</intitulé_du_diplome>
<lieu_obtention>Ecole Supérieure de Technologie et de Management</lieu_obtention>
<mention_obtenue>Assez-bien</mention_obtenue>
</diplome_obtenu>
<diplome_obtenu>
<intitulé_du_diplome>Bac S2</intitulé_du_diplome>
<lieu_obtention>Lycée Lamine GUEYE</lieu_obtention>
<mention_obtenue>Passable</mention_obtenue>
</diplome_obtenu>
<diplome_preparé>
<intitulé_du_diplomes>Master 1 TéléInformatique</intitulé_du_diplomes>
<lieu_formation>Ecole Supérieure de Technologie et de Management</lieu_formation>
</diplome_preparé>
</formation>

<compétences>
<compétence>VBA,C,C++,JAVA,HTML,PHP,JavaScript, AJAX, XML,PL SQL,SQL ,etc</compétence>
<compétence>Bases de Données (Oracle, MySQL, SQL SERVER)</compétence>
<compétence>Concéption (Mérise, UML)</compétence>
<compétence>Réseaux et Sécurité</compétence>
<compétence>Administration Système (2003 SERVEUR, LINUX))</compétence>
</compétences>

<expérience_professionnelle>
<nbre_mois> 11 </nbre_mois>
<expérience>
<date_début>09 Mars 2008</date_début>
<date_fin>31 Octobre 2008</date_fin>
<description>Stage de mise en situation professionnelle à la BOA </description>
</expérience>
<expérience>
<date_début>27 Novembre 2008</date_début>
<date_fin>13 Mars 2009</date_fin>
<description> Contractuel à SENSOFT</description>
</expérience>
</expérience_professionnelle>
</demandeur>

<demandeur matricule="M02">

<objetDemande>Emploi</objetDemande>

<infoGénérale>
<nom>Ibrahima GUEYE</nom>
<date_de_naissance>08/12/1985 </date_de_naissance>
<adresse>12, Rue 5 Escale Nord (Dakar)</adresse>
<nationalité> Sénégalaise</nationalité>
<tel> (00221)773141728</tel>
<email> aly.camara@senebank.sn</email>
<civilité>Célibataire</civilité>
<photo> ./images/M02.gif</photo>
</infoGénérale>

<formation>
<spécialisation>Informatique</spécialisation>
<diplome_obtenu>
<intitulé_du_diplome>Licence Professionnelle en TéléInformatique</intitulé_du_diplome>
<lieu_obtention>Ecole Supérieure de Technologie et de Management</lieu_obtention>
<mention_obtenue>Assez-bien</mention_obtenue>
</diplome_obtenu>
<diplome_obtenu>
<intitulé_du_diplome>Bac S2</intitulé_du_diplome>
<lieu_obtention>Lycée Lamine GUEYE</lieu_obtention>
<mention_obtenue>Passable</mention_obtenue>
</diplome_obtenu>

<diplome_preparé>
<intitulé_du_diplomes>Master 1 TéléInformatique</intitulé_du_diplomes>
<lieu_formation>Ecole Supérieure de Technologie et de Management</lieu_formation>
</diplome_preparé>
</formation>

<compétences>
<compétence>VBA,C,C++,JAVA,HTML,PHP,JavaScript, AJAX, XML,PL SQL,SQL ,etc</compétence>
<compétence>Bases de Données (Oracle, MySQL, SQL SERVER)</compétence>
<compétence>Concéption (Mérise, UML)</compétence>
<compétence>Réseaux et Sécurité</compétence>
<compétence>Administration Système (2003 SERVEUR, LINUX))</compétence>
</compétences>

<expérience_professionnelle>
<nbre_mois> 11 </nbre_mois>
<expérience>
<date_début>09 Mars 2008</date_début>
<date_fin>31 Octobre 2008</date_fin>
<description>Stage de mise en situation professionnelle à la BOA </description>
</expérience>
<expérience>
<date_début>27 Novembre 2008</date_début>
<date_fin>13 Mars 2009</date_fin>
<description> Contractuel à SENSOFT</description>
</expérience>
</expérience_professionnelle>
</demandeur>

<demandeur matricule="M03">

<objetDemande>Emploi</objetDemande>

<infoGénérale>

<nom>Coumba Ndiaye</nom>
<date_de_naissance>08/12/1987 </date_de_naissance>
<adresse>12, Rue 5 Escale Nord (Dakar)</adresse>
<nationalité> Sénégalaise</nationalité>
<tel> (00221)773141728</tel>
<email> aly.camara@senebank.sn</email>
<civilité>Célibataire</civilité>
<photo> ./images/M01.gif</photo>
</infoGénérale>

<formation>
<spécialisation>Informatique</spécialisation>
<diplome_obtenu>
<intitulé_du_diplome>Licence Professionnelle en TéléInformatique</intitulé_du_diplome>
<lieu_obtention>Ecole Supérieure de Technologie et de Management</lieu_obtention>
<mention_obtenue>Assez-bien</mention_obtenue>
</diplome_obtenu>
<diplome_obtenu>
<intitulé_du_diplome>Bac S2</intitulé_du_diplome>
<lieu_obtention>Galandou Diouf</lieu_obtention>
<mention_obtenue>Assez-bien</mention_obtenue>
</diplome_obtenu>

<diplome_preparé>
<intitulé_du_diplomes>Master 1 TéléInformatique</intitulé_du_diplomes>
<lieu_formation>Ecole Supérieure de Technologie et de Management</lieu_formation>
</diplome_preparé>
</formation>

<compétences>
<compétence>VBA,C,C++,JAVA,HTML,PHP,JavaScript, AJAX, XML,PL SQL,SQL ,etc</compétence>
<compétence>Bases de Données (Oracle, MySQL, SQL SERVER)</compétence>
<compétence>Concéption (Mérise, UML)</compétence>
<compétence>Réseaux et Sécurité</compétence>
<compétence>Administration Système (2003 SERVEUR, LINUX))</compétence>
</compétences>

<expérience_professionnelle>
<nbre_mois> 11 </nbre_mois>
<expérience>
<date_début>09 Mars 2008</date_début>
<date_fin>31 Octobre 2008</date_fin>
<description>Stage de mise en situation professionnelle à la BOA </description>
</expérience>
<expérience>
<date_début>27 Novembre 2008</date_début>
<date_fin>13 Mars 2009</date_fin>
<description> Contractuel à SENSOFT</description>
</expérience>
</expérience_professionnelle>
</demandeur>

<demandeur matricule="M11">

<objetDemande>Emploi</objetDemande>

<infoGénérale>
<nom>Amy colé Ndiaye</nom>
<date_de_naissance>08/12/1985</date_de_naissance>
<adresse>Pikine Nord</adresse>
<nationalité> Sénégalaise</nationalité>
<tel> (00221)778141728</tel>
<email> amy.ndiaye@senebank.sn</email>
<civilité>Célibataire</civilité>
<photo> ./images/M11.gif</photo>
</infoGénérale>

<formation>
<spécialisation>Télécommunications</spécialisation>
<diplome_obtenu>
<intitulé_du_diplome>Master 2 en Télécoms</intitulé_du_diplome>
<lieu_obtention>Ecole Supérieure de Technologie et de Management</lieu_obtention>
<mention_obtenue>Très-bien</mention_obtenue>
</diplome_obtenu>
<diplome_obtenu>
<intitulé_du_diplome>Licence Professionnelle en Télécoms</intitulé_du_diplome>
<lieu_obtention>Ecole Supérieure de Technologie et de Management</lieu_obtention>
<mention_obtenue>Très-bien</mention_obtenue>
</diplome_obtenu>
<diplome_obtenu>
<intitulé_du_diplome>Bac S1</intitulé_du_diplome>
<lieu_obtention>Lycée Lamine GUEYE</lieu_obtention>
<mention_obtenue>Bien</mention_obtenue>
</diplome_obtenu>

<diplome_preparé>
<intitulé_du_diplomes>Master 2 en management NTIC</intitulé_du_diplomes>
<lieu_formation>Ecole Supérieure de Technologie et de Management</lieu_formation>
</diplome_preparé>
</formation>

<compétences>
<compétence>C,C++,JAVA,HTML,PHP,JavaScript, AJAX, XML,PL SQL,SQL</compétence>
<compétence>Traitement de signal</compétence>
<compétence>Web sémantique</compétence>
<compétence>Bases de Données (Oracle, MySQL, SQL SERVER)</compétence>
<compétence>Concéption (Mérise, UML)</compétence>
<compétence>Réseaux et Sécurité</compétence>
<compétence>Administration Système (2003 SERVEUR, LINUX))</compétence>
<compétence>Téléphonie IP (avec Astérisk)</compétence>
</compétences>

<expérience_professionnelle>
<nbre_mois> 23 </nbre_mois>
<expérience>
<date_début>09 Mars 2007</date_début>
<date_fin>31 Octobre 2008</date_fin>
<description>Stage de mise en situation professionnelle au CMS </description>
</expérience>
<expérience>
<date_début>27 Novembre 2008</date_début>
<date_fin>13 Mars 2009</date_fin>
<description> Contractuel à la SONATEL</description>
</expérience>
</expérience_professionnelle>
</demandeur>

<demandeur matricule="M12">

<objetDemande>Stage</objetDemande>

<infoGénérale>
<nom>Cristian Castan</nom>
<date_de_naissance>08/12/1990</date_de_naissance>
<adresse>14, Rue nani Fann Hock</adresse>
<nationalité> Gabonais</nationalité>
<tel> (00221)779141728</tel>
<email> cristian.castan@senebank.sn</email>
<civilité>Célibataire</civilité>
</infoGénérale>

<formation>
<spécialisation>Electronique</spécialisation>
<diplome_obtenu>
<intitulé_du_diplome>Diplôme de Technicien Supérieur</intitulé_du_diplome>
<lieu_obtention>Ecole Supérieure Polytechnique de Dakar</lieu_obtention>
<mention_obtenue>Bien</mention_obtenue>
</diplome_obtenu>
<diplome_obtenu>
<intitulé_du_diplome>Bac Technique</intitulé_du_diplome>
<lieu_obtention>Lycée Lamine GUEYE</lieu_obtention>
<mention_obtenue>Passable</mention_obtenue>
</diplome_obtenu>
</formation>

<compétences>
<compétence>HTML,PHP,MYSQL,C</compétence>
<compétence>Concéption avec Mérise</compétence>
<compétence>Interconnexion de Réseaux</compétence>
<compétence>Système LINUX</compétence>
</compétences>

</demandeur>

</base_de_cv>

Je voudrais l'afficher ainsi

Quelqu'un peut-il m'aider ?
A voir également:

2 réponses

Salut,

tu pourrais utiliser xslt.

https://www.google.ch/search?q=xslt

Bonne journée

׺°"~'"°º×]|I{*------» LÖBÖTÖ «------*}I|[׺°"~'"°º×
0
cisko123 Messages postés 3 Date d'inscription vendredi 22 mai 2015 Statut Membre Dernière intervention 23 mai 2015
23 mai 2015 à 22:12
Wéé .. mé je l'ait déja fait avec xslt ... j voudrais le faire avec css
0
Wéé mais sinon tu peux écrire "style xml" dans google et cliquer sur le premier lien qui va expliquer comment faire.

http://www.lehtml.com/xml/xml_css.html
0